Edible Garden AG Incorporated Warrant (EDBLW) is trading at $0.07, reflecting a modest decline of 1.21% from its previous close. The stock is holding within a narrow range with both support and resistance currently identified at the same $0.07 level, indicating extremely tight price action and low volatility for this warrant.

Volume patterns for EDBLW are consistent with its status as a lightly traded warrant, with typical daily turnover remaining low compared to the common stock. The warrant’s 1.21% decline occurred on what appears to be normal trading activity, lacking any sudden spike in volume that would suggest institutional accumulation or distribution. Sector-wise, Edible Garden AG operates in the agricultural technology space, focusing on hydroponic and organic produce. This niche sector has seen mixed sentiment recently, with small-cap agtech names often trading on company-specific news rather than broad market trends. The warrant’s price movement today appears to be a routine adjustment following the prior session’s close, with no clear sector-wide catalyst driving the change. The $0.07 level has been acting as both a floor and a ceiling, reflecting a market that is uncertain about the warrant’s near-term valuation. Given the low price and thin trading, even small orders can cause outsized percentage moves, though today’s 1.21% change falls within a normal range for this instrument. The absence of notable news from the company further suggests that the move is technical or noise-driven rather than fundamentally motivated. From a technical perspective, EDBLW is exhibiting an exceptionally tight trading range with support and resistance both pinned at $0.07. This configuration suggests the stock is in a period of price consolidation or equilibrium, where buying and selling pressures are finely balanced. Price action over the recent sessions has likely formed a narrow lateral channel, with the warrant unable to break decisively above or below this level.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I), would likely be situated in the neutral zone — potentially in the high 40s to low 50s range — reflecting the lack of directional conviction. Moving averages, if calculated over short periods, would converge near $0.07 as well, reinforcing the consolidation pattern. The absence of a clear trend is typical for warrants that trade infrequently; however, any expansion in range could signal a breakout. Volume analysis shows no unusual accumulation, so the likelihood of a sudden trend reversal remains low without a catalyst. The warrant’s price is trading near its intrinsic value relative to the underlying common stock (Edible Garden AG, ticker EDBL), but the tight spread between bid and ask may also be contributing to the static price. Traders should note that low-priced warrants like EDBLW can experience gap moves if the underlying equity makes a significant move.
